We were going to upgrade to 8.2 from 8.1, but now that 9.0 has been released, should we wait for 9.0 to stabilize and then go directly to 9.0?

(imported comment written by SystemAdmin)

Hi MBARTOSH,

I recommend you to upgrade to 9.0 (when stabilized if you’d like to) because the bug fixes from now on will be shipped more frequently as the patches of 9.0. Also basically IEM 9.0 has already included some bug fixes since the last patch of TEM 8.2 was released.

I always question the first release of any major release. The following patch release, I find, typically fixes any critical bugs found in the first iteration of a major release, just my experience. I am super impressed by the mailboxing feature in 9.0. I was tailing a client log (client connecting directly to server) and saw the action hit the client before the take action dialog even disappeared in the console.

Tip: Ensure that you upgrade relay components ahead of client components to ensure relays do not break during upgrade.
